How do you pronounce “reshaping”?

“reshaping” is pronounced ree-SHAY-ping — IPA /ɹiˈʃeɪpɪŋ/. In Ingglish phonetic spelling, where every spelling always makes the same sound, it is written “reeshayping”.

How many syllables are in “reshaping”?

“reshaping” has 3 syllables: ree-SHAY-ping (the capitalized syllable is stressed).
